Product description

This manual pallet stacker is designed for lifting, stacking, and storing pallets and palletised goods at various heights. Manufactured with a sturdy powder-coated steel frame and boasting high weight load capacities, this stacker is suitable for regular use in warehouses, distribution centres, and stockrooms. The manual pallet stacker has an ergonomic pump handle and foot pump, giving you a choice of operation. The stackers are sturdy and compact, constructed from robust steel profiles.

  • Powder-coated steel construction
  • Ergonomic, rubber-coated pump handle
  • High load capacities (500kg, 1000kg, 1500kg)
  • Fully adjustable lowering speed
  • 150mm nylon wheels

Hand-Operated Pallet Stacker

  • Width-adjustable forks fitted as standard, so it can also handle other (smaller or larger) open-bottom pallets with ease
  • Designed with a hand and foot pump
  • Compact for use in narrow spaces
  • Choose between five lift heights: 1200mm, 1500mm, 1600mm, 2500mm, or 3000mm

What’s The Difference Between A Pallet Truck And Pallet Stacker?

Both stacker trucks and pallet lifts are useful handling and access equipment in industrial and commercial environments, but they’re designed for different purposes. Pallet trucks are designed to transport pallets and palletised goods horizontally, while pallet stackers work like manual forklifts; they’re used to lift, stack, and store pallets at various heights.

What’s The Difference Between Standard And Straddle Leg Pallet Stackers?

Standard leg pallet stackers have legs that sit under the forks, allowing them to lift open-bottom pallets by fitting between the bottom boards. Straddle leg stackers offer greater versatility; the legs sit wider than the forks, allowing them to lift various pallet types and sizes, including closed-bottom pallets.

Where Can A Manual Forklift Pallet Stacker​ Be Used?

A manual pallet stacker is an indispensable piece of equipment in any environment that frequently needs to load, unload, and stack pallets. It’s typically used in warehouses, factories, and distribution centres, but the narrow frame allows it to be used in smaller spaces, such as storerooms.
